Description
Hawaiian Roll French Toast is a delightful twist on a breakfast classic, transforming sweet Hawaiian rolls into a decadent dish. This easy recipe involves soaking the rolls in a rich egg mixture and cooking them until golden brown. Ingredients
Scale
- 6 Hawaiian Sweet Rolls
- 4 large eggs
- 1 cup whole milk
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on
- 2 tsp vanilla extract
- 2 tbsp butter (for cooking)
- Maple syrup (for serving)
Instructions
- Slice Hawaiian rolls in half horizontally.
- In a b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, cinnamon, and vanilla until smooth.
- Dip each roll half into the egg mixture, allowing it to soak for about 20 seconds per side.
- Heat skillet over medium heat and melt butter. Place soaked rolls cut-side down in the skillet.
- Cook until golden brown on both sides (approximately 3 minutes per side).
- Serve warm with maple syrup and your choice of toppings.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
